Hyne

Hyne Timber had its beginnings when pioneer Richard Matthews Hyne started a sawmilling operation on the banks of the Mary River in 1882. Through five generations of the Hyne family of Maryborough, operations have expanded across eastern Australia from Cairns in far North Queensland to Melbourne in Victoria.

With extensive interests in timber processing, wholesaling and exporting, the company’s operations include sawmills, timber manufacturing plants and distribution outlets.

The company produces a large range of products for domestic, industrial and commercial applications. Products such as engineered timber products from both hardwood and softwood in glue laminated timber.These products are branded Hyne-I-Beam T2, Hynebeam and Hyne Edgebeam LGL, have proven performance in longevity and structural strength, while allowing timber structures to have greater spans. Hyne Timber also produces hardwood flooring, furniture and timber components, building poles, decking, termite resistant structural framing, joinery components and more.

Tilling Timber

Tilling Timber Pty Ltd is a privately owned Australian company established in 1963, and is one of Australia's largest timber wholesaler/importers. Tilling offer a diverse range of solid timbers and timber products, sourced from sustainably grown forests in Australia and around the world.

Tilling are manufacturers and suppliers of wood profiles, including architectural mouldings, internal panelling, exterior claddings, shingles, timber window components and much more.
In addition to traditional solid timber flooring, Tilling proudly manufacture Till-Cote, a pre-finished solid timber overlay flooring system.

And SmartFrame - Smart Engineered Solutions is a full range of Laminated Veneer Lumber, I-Joists and Glulam beams. SmartFrame is backed up by a state of the art CD-ROM, including the SmartFrame software package as well as the convenience of a full technical library.

Fletcher Insulation

Fletcher Insulation, a division of Fletcher Building, has the vision “To be the leading marketer and manufacturer of environmentally sustainable insulation, providing cost effective comfortable living.” It is the only insulation manufacturer in the world to manufacture and market the leading types of insulation in glasswool, polyester and reflective foil insulation products.  Its key brands are Pink Batts and Fat Batt.

Fletcher Insulation has become the first Australian glasswool insulation manufacturer to be awarded the rigorous Good Environmental Choice Australia certification (GECA) and the much sort after Goldmark label issued by the Australia Building Codes Board. The company has also recently achieved the Global-mark certification for its products that conform to AS/NZS 4859.2002.

Ecospecifier

Ecospecifier is an award-winning tool for professionals in the built environment. The on-line database comprises around 1,000 eco-friendly and health-preferable building materials and technologies. Ecospecifier is more than a database though, providing information on how to design and deliver buildings, interiors and surrounds using environmentally preferable products available in Australia. The extensive product database is complemented by the educational knowledgebase component of Ecospecifier which provides in-depth reporting on difficult topics within the Green Building Movement especially pertaining to the environmental and health issues surrounding materials.

Ecospecifier is a not for profit organisation led by the sustainability consultancy ‘Natural Integrated Living’. The service is designed to serve its users by providing an easy to navigate, unbiased source of information and networking to environmentally responsible materials and then take a further step by providing the research data to help users back up their decisions for opting to specify or purchase 'green alternatives'.
